Project Overview
El Otro: Bass Lines is a cinematic exploration of isolation, perseverance, and the raw power of nature. Set in a vast desert landscape, the project follows one man's journey through sand, stone, and silence as he climbs toward his limits—both physical and mental. With a pulsating electronic soundtrack, the film captures the tension between stillness and movement, solitude and survival.
Cinematography & Techniques
To bring this vision to life, we used aerial drone cinematography to highlight the scale of the barren terrain, complemented by ground-level shots to emphasize the human struggle against nature. Slow-motion sequences were used to enhance emotional weight, especially during moments of action and fall. Natural lighting, filtered through dust and haze, added warmth and grit to the visual tone, reinforcing the harsh beauty of the setting.
Visual Storytelling
The narrative unfolds as a wordless, rhythmic journey. A lone man ventures into desolate mountains, driven by an unseen purpose. His climb is both literal and symbolic—culminating in a fall that interrupts the silence with urgency. A helicopter rescue closes the loop, but leaves space for interpretation. Every shot is timed to the beat of deep bass lines, blending music and motion into one immersive flow.
